Abstract

Combining profiles based on priorities associated therewith to create an effective profile are provided. A plurality of profiles defining one or more rules that are applicable to a functional computing object are identified. A priority corresponding to each applicable profile is determined. The applicable profiles are combined by the computing device based on the corresponding priorities to create an effective profile that includes no conflicting rules.
